Court Overturns Rape Conviction Over Witness Statement, Recollection

By LOLLY BOWEAN
Capital News Service
March 1, 2000

ANNAPOLIS - The Court of Special Appeals Wednesday overturned the rape conviction of a Prince George's County man, ruling that a written statement taken by police officers was hearsay and was improperly used during a trial where the chief witness could not remember details of the crime.
